    I would suspect that Engineer is probably talking about revenue going down. I know its hit or miss for me with Revenue Giants. We'll have an occasional good month which keeps them on the site. However break down for me in 2011:

    Jan - Number 6 in terms of traffic I sent, #18 in terms of revenue
    Feb - Number 6 in terms of traffic I sent, #13 in terms of revenue
    Mar - Number 6 in terms of traffic I sent, #14 in terms of revenue
    April - Number 8 in terms of traffic I sent, #22 in terms of revenue

    ---

    2006 - 5th for amount of traffic, 5th for revenue
    2007 - 5th for amount of traffic, 3rd for revenue
    2008 - 5th for amount of traffic, 9th for revenue
    2009 - 6th for amount of traffic, 8th for revenue
    2010 - 8th for amount of traffic, 9th for revenue
    2011 - 6th for amount of traffic, 17th for revenue

    Miss M. - you've always been nice and helped out when I complain but the trend is simply that the clicks aren't worth as much as they were in the past.

    Example in 2006 - I only sent 609 visitors - but made more than I did in 2011 so far after sending over 7000 visitors!

    In 2007 I made 8x the amount I made this year on the same traffic numbers.

    ---

    As to the original post, nobody else charges me for a check. I consider that stuff nickle-n-dime. It just puts you in a bad light with affiliates. You also have a 1000$ minimum payment clause so anyone you're paying with a check should be worth the $40 to you.

    ---

    My 2 cents on the matter. Nothing bad on revenue giants, I just understand where The Engineer is coming from.

    Are you talking about casino or bingo traffic? The thing, I think, with Revenue Giants, is this: their bingo affiliates, like me, love them because they are the best converting U-S-A facing bingo program. However, it seems that the same doesn't apply to their casino affiliates.

    You are going to get some very polarized opinions about Revenue Giants on that basis alone.

    I'd be interested to know what traffic you are sending - as it's fairly clear that you're not making the bucks you were.
